    I'm Rich Anderson, analyst and historian, author or co-author of:

    Hitler's Last Gamble
    Artillery Hell
    Cracking Hitler's Atlantic Wall

    I am currently working on a history if the development of the U.S. Armored Force, its doctrine, organiztion, and equipment, and how it affected the U.S. Army's wartime involvement.

    Other back-burner projects are the Battle of Mont Castre, an in-depth examination of the German forces in Ob. West c. 1 June 1944 (an expansion of my friend Niklas Zetterling's seminal work) and a companion volume on the Allied forces assembled for NEPTUNE.

    I am also interested in the American Civil War, military history in general, and many other subjects.

    Thanks Andy, I'm actually in the NCR although my job doesn't give me much time ant more to get to Archives II. If you haven't, you should ask to go through the records of OCMH and the research files for American Forces in Action and the Green Books. They are a treasure trove of first hand accounts, many of which have never been published.
